3-Hydroxy-pyridinium hydrogen chloranilate monohydrate.


ABSTRACT: In the title salt hydrate, C(5)H(6)NO(+)·C(6)HCl(2)O(4) (-)·H(2)O, the three components are held together by O-H?O and N-H?O hydrogen bonds, as well as by C-H?O contacts, forming a double-tape structure along the c axis. Within each tape, the pyridinium ring and the chloranilate ring are almost coplanar, forming a dihedral angle of 2.35?(7)°.
